FINANCIAL VIABILITY ASSESSMENT

A good corporate financial decision starts with numbers. Most of the numbers come from financial statements prepared by accountants. However, the financial statements do not disclose all of the necessary and relevant information for decision making. Therefore, it is necessary to analyse the data depicted in the financial statements. This training will empower delegates in taking sound corporate financial decision based on numbers in their respective organizations by helping in developing their knowledge on the financial viability analysis.

Course Objectives

Upon completion, delegates will be able to;

  • Describe the key metrics used to evaluate the financial viability of a Private Public Partnership
  • (PPP) project
  • Comprehend the process for toll revenue forecasting
  • Evaluate capital investments, financing options and cash flows
  • Describe the role of financial models and list key inputs and outputs
